Myanmar football stars join ASEAN awareness campaign amid pandemic

THE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) and FIFA have recently launched a joint campaign featuring regional football stars, and two Myanmar young football stars Myat Noe Khin and Nanda Kyaw participated in the event.

 

The goal is to encourage citizens to be active, and live a healthy and active lifestyle amidst the COVID-19 outbreak.

William Ramirez, in his capacity as the Chair of the ASEAN Ministerial Meeting on Sports also delivered speech in the campaign that, “The ASEAN sports sector is currently focusing, among others, on strengthening the contribution of sports to ASEAN community-building. During this pandemic, it is important for us to work hand in hand with our key partners. We are pleased to collaborate with FIFA in this campaign to leverage the role of sports in social development”.

 

The campaign videos also mark the first initiative for ASEAN and FIFA since signing an agreement in November 2019 on the sidelines of the 35th ASEAN Summit in Bangkok to implement joint activities. —Lynn Thit (Tgi)
